Websoluble in water and in ethanol (96 per cent). Assay. Dissolve 0.600 g in a mixture of 5 mL ofnitric acid R and 50 mL of water R.Add50.0mLof0.1 M silver nitrate and 3 mL of dibutyl phthalate R and shake. Using 2 mL of ferric ammonium sulfate solution R2as indicator, titrate with 0.1 M ammonium thiocyanate until a reddish-yellow colour is obtained. Webswells. When fully hydrated, the shell starts to dissolve. The amount of time it takes for water to penetrate capsule shells varies, depending on the nature of the capsules shell and other factors. This time has been reported to be approximately 40 s for gelatin capsules and about 3 min for HPMC capsules. WebPerson as author : Pontier, L.
